So I have a question for a homebrew subclass I'm working on for druid heavily focusing on their wild shape. My question is would it be balanced if starting at level two druids could wild shape into any beast who's CR matches their druid level? this would go from One all the way up to 20 but they cannot use any spells The thought being they put all their training all their effort into mastering wild shape they gain no stats only the actions reactions and bonus actions of the creature.
That would be very unbalanced. Consider that the effect you are describing is similar to polymorph, a 4th level spell, except that your effect is way cheaper and better in just about every way.
